This has always bothered me. It states in the spell invisibility that you are not magically silenced, and other factors like walking through puddles, can reveal your presence. I would argue that the above only applies to the vision part of perception. for the hearing part, should the person invisible use stealth to move the perception would be just his stealth and 0 for being invisible, plus distance. If he is moving in things like dust, snow, water etc. then he would leave tracks, unless he has way's of avoiding making them. If the invisible creature move without using stealth, then it would only be distance for the sound part.
